Quality Assurance

Understanding the service
Real value. Tangible results
Quality Assurance
process
Test Planning
We design a comprehensive QA plan, including manual and automated testing strategies, timelines, resources, and tools required.
Test Case Design
We create detailed test cases and scenarios based on real user behavior to ensure complete coverage of functional and non-functional aspects.
Environment Setup
We prepare a stable and secure test environment that mirrors production settings to simulate real-world conditions.
Requirements Analysis
We review the business and technical requirements to define a clear QA strategy tailored to the product’s goals and scope.
Test Execution (Manual & Automated)
Our QA team performs rigorous manual and automated testing to identify bugs, performance issues, and usability concerns.
Defect Reporting and Tracking
We log all identified defects with detailed documentation and collaborate with development teams for timely resolution.
Regression Testing
Once fixes are applied, we run regression tests to ensure that changes haven't affected existing functionalities.
Performance and Stability Testing
We evaluate system performance under different loads and conditions to guarantee reliability and scalability.
Final QA Sign-off
After all tests are passed and issues resolved, we provide final approval for release, ensuring the product meets quality standards.
Post-Release Support
We offer support during and after deployment to quickly address any unforeseen issues and ensure a smooth transition to production.
